PsychoPy

PsychoPy

PsychoPy is a powerful, open-source SuperLab alternative written in Python, making it highly customizable for neuroscience and experimental psychology research. It's freely available and boasts excellent cross-platform support for Mac, Windows, and Linux. OpenSesame

OpenSesame

OpenSesame stands out as a graphical, open-source experiment builder, providing a modern and intuitive user interface for building complex experiments, much like SuperLab. It's a fantastic free SuperLab alternative available across Mac, Windows, Linux, and even Android, offering broad accessibility. Key features include its cross-platform nature and extensibility through plugins and extensions, allowing researchers to tailor it to their precise needs.

DMDX

DMDX

DMDX is a free, Windows-based display system widely used in psychological laboratories for precise reaction time measurements to visual and auditory stimuli. While it focuses primarily on Windows, its specific optimization for millisecond accuracy makes it a strong contender for researchers who prioritize precise timing, potentially serving as a direct SuperLab alternative for certain experimental designs.

Paradigm

Paradigm

Paradigm offers flexible and millisecond-accurate stimulus presentation, essential for cognitive neuroscience, psychology, and linguistics research. This commercial SuperLab alternative for Windows allows users to build experiments using its robust features, including Python scripting and medical filing capabilities. Its emphasis on precision and advanced features makes it suitable for demanding research environments.
